    "Around the World in Eighty Days" is a timeless literary adventure that takes readers on a thrilling journey across continents and cultures. Penned by the visionary French author Jules Verne in 1872, this classic novel continues to captivate the imagination of readers worldwide with its blend of excitement, humor, and exploration.At the heart of the narrative is the indomitable Phileas Fogg, an enigmatic English gentleman known for his precise habits and unyielding punctuality. Fogg, armed with an unshakable belief in the reliability of train schedules and timetables, wagers half of his considerable fortune that he can circumnavigate the globe in a mere eighty days. The stakes are high, and the clock is ticking as Fogg embarks on an extraordinary adventure that will test his mettle and challenge the boundaries of what was deemed possible in the 19th century.The journey unfolds as Fogg, accompanied by his loyal and resourceful servant, Jean Passepartout, races against time, encountering a plethora of fascinating characters and navigating a series of unexpected challenges. From the bustling streets of Victorian London to the exotic landscapes of India, the rugged terrains of the American West, and the mysterious realms of Asia, Fogg's odyssey showcases the rich tapestry of cultures and landscapes that span the globe.What makes "Around the World in Eighty Days" a literary masterpiece is not only its gripping plot but also Verne's keen observations of the world during an era marked by technological advancements and the spirit of exploration. The novel paints a vivid portrait of a rapidly changing world, where steamships, trains, and telegraphs were revolutionizing the way people connected and communicated.Verne's narrative is sprinkled with wit and humor, making the journey not only an epic adventure but also a delightful exploration of the human spirit. As Fogg races against time, readers are treated to a symphony of cultural nuances, unexpected twists, and the triumph of ingenuity over adversity.This literary gem has stood the test of time, inspiring countless adaptations, including films, television series, and theatrical productions.     "Robur-le-Conquérant" est un roman de Jules Verne publié en 1886. L'histoire met en scène Robur, un inventeur audacieux et visionnaire, qui développe un aéronef révolutionnaire, l'Albatros, un dirigeable à propulsion électrique. Ce roman explore les confrontations entre Robur et des personnages qui voyagent à bord de l'Albatros. Verne aborde des thèmes tels que les avancées technologiques, les conflits entre tradition et progrès, ainsi que les idées sur la puissance et l'utilisation de la technologie. "Robur-le-Conquérant" est reconnu pour son anticipation des voyages aériens et pour ses réflexions sur les impacts sociaux et éthiques de la technologie.

    Erik Hersebom est un jeune Norvégien doté d'une remarquable intelligence. Il y a cependant quelque chose qui cloche en lui : il n'a pas du tout les traits physiques caractéristiques des peuples scandinaves. Il a toute l'apparence d'un Celte. Le docteur Schwaryencrona le prend sous son aile et finit par découvrir qu'Erik a été adopté par une famille de pêcheurs norvégiens, après avoir été sauvé du naufrage du Cynthia alors qu'il n'avait que quelques mois. Une fois grand, avec l'aide du Docteur, Erik va chercher à élucider le mystère du naufrage du Cynthia pour retrouver une trace de ses origines. Cette quête le mènera à travers les glaces polaires jusqu'en Sibérie...
